I trusted Lowes to install my windows last year. It's been 14 months and now that it has started raining, my window is leaking like crazy. I called to see if they could help me out and because of the 1 year installation warranty I'm pretty much screwed. I spent a pretty penny for these windows and now I'm left without support. I wish I would've chose a different company to install my windows. If I could give zero I would. Upon further review: looks like they only did half of the window with epoxy. The part that is not filled is where it is leaking. It's also open in the corner

This is my home store and I appreciate that they're usually pretty stocked. And there's usually enough employees to help you out throughout the store. The cons though is always having to use self checkout but if you're buying a gift card you have to go to the customer service which can take awhile when people are picking up and or returning items. Another con can become a liability for them. The woman's bathroom doors are either installed improperly or falling apart but they swing back at you when you're trying to go into a stall. For a moment I thought someone was in a stall and pushed the door back into my face! So beware of the stall doors or don't use the woman's restroom.

Lowe's at this location is genuinely a cut above the rest, especially when compared to the nearby Home Depot. The moment I walked in, I was met with an open, well-organized atmosphere that was fully stocked. It was refreshing to navigate aisles that were both clean and uncrowded. Also note that the selection was much better also at Lowe's. For example, they had backyard. Misters were as Home Depot did not. Note that both Home Depot and Lowe's both offer 10% military discount as long as you pre-register on their website and verify with your ID.me account also, they price match so the value was definitely there. International. The service? Absolutely on point. The employees were attentive and ready to assist. It's such a stark contrast to the congested and often chaotic feel of Home Depot just a mile away. In fact, the difference is so pronounced that it feels like Lowe's operates in a different league altogether. A possible reason for this superior shopping experience could be the noticeably fewer customers at this Lowe's, making it feel like a breath of fresh air. Regardless of the reason, I'll be choosing Lowe's over its competition any day. Highly recommended!

The best hardware store in the area, hands down. In an era of "big box" stores a gem like…read moreFranklin's is an oasis. Sometimes I'll go to one of the more "convenient" home improvement chains, but 80% of the time after looking through aisles and aisles of cookie-cutter boxes of hardware designed for contractors I will come up empty handed and head over to Franklin's wondering why I didn't just start here. I have always, ALWAYS, found the hardware I need, no matter how obscure the screw, nut, or fitting, at Franklin. Tiny brass screws to fix an antique clock? They'll have it. "Euro" style screws that came with your cheap Ikea cabinet? They'll have it. A bushing for a kitchen appliance that is an odd size... they will have it. Additionally the folks who work here are super friendly and helpful! Another reason why anyone looking for anything a hardware store carries should start here. There is a small parking lot in the back, and metered parking on the street. They are an "Ace" hardware franchise so if you need to pick up an order from the Ace website this is a location that you can select (I've done this several times). They also do re-screening, and knife sharpening. It's truly one of the last remaining neighborhood hardware stores and I can't recommend it highly enough.

Location 4 stars: In the Porter Ranch Town Center's West end, in the former Toys R Us building…read more Plenty of free self parking on premises. Venue 4 stars: Large and modern. Well structured and offering a full selection of DIY and home and garden goods. They are not as builder/contractor oriented as say Home Depot or Lowes, but great for everyday needs. One great thing is that they are never busy. It is easy to get in and out quickly. Main reasons that I could see for the lack of crowds compared to other hardware superstores is the low turnout of contractors and the higher prices (discussed further down). Service 3 stars: I have always found this aspect of Ace Hardware hard to rate. Sometimes you walk in and there are smiling faces everywhere, greeting you and asking you if you need any help. Other times you will not find anyone to assist you and keep wandering the aisles. Overall service is better than Home Depot or Lowes but it could also be much better! Merchandise 3.5 stars: Again not as elaborate as Home Depot or Lowes, but good enough for a neighborhood hardware superstore when you need something quick. Convenience 4.5 stars: For me, they are the closest hardware superstore, about a mile away. Next closest are Lowes in Northridge (4.5 miles) and Home Depot in Canoga Park (7.5 miles). Not having to fight traffic, compete for parking spots, parking next to huge work trucks and getting dinged by them or the lumber carts, and not paying extra for gas is worth it, especially when I need something in a jiffy. Prices 2 stars: Generally much higher than Home Depot or Lowes. In one instance, a part that was $10.99 at Lowes, Home Depot AND Amazon, was $13.99 at Ace. This is 27% higher! Now every price may not be this much higher but as a general rule always expect to pay more for the convenience. The Bottom Line 4 stars: Convenience and lack of crowds wins it for me!
